Ouray KOA Holiday is conveniently located at 225 Co Rd 23, Ridgway, CO 81432, USA. This strategic position places it beautifully between the artistic town of Ridgway and the "Switzerland of America," Ouray. The campground sits amidst acres of stunning landscape, providing captivating views of the San Juan Mountains in every direction. Its elevation offers refreshing mountain air and a respite from warmer temperatures found at lower altitudes.
Accessibility to the campground is excellent, as County Road 23 is easily reached from US Highway 550, a major scenic route. If you're coming from Montrose, you'll turn right on County Road 23 at mile marker 98. If you're approaching from Ouray, you'll take a left onto County Road 23. This straightforward access makes it a convenient drive for various vehicles, including large RVs. Driving times from Colorado's major cities are manageable for a longer weekend or week-long trip: approximately 4.5 to 5 hours from Denver, about 4 hours from Colorado Springs, and around 1.5 hours from Grand Junction. This accessible yet nestled location allows visitors to easily explore the region's abundant attractions while enjoying the peace of a mountain setting.
Services Offered:
- Variety of Accommodations: Ouray KOA Holiday offers diverse camping options including spacious RV sites with full hookups (30 and 50 amp), pull-through and back-in sites, deluxe cabins with full bathrooms and kitchenettes, camping cabins, and gravel tent sites with picnic tables and fire pits.
- Clean Restrooms and Showers: Guests frequently highlight the cleanliness and quality of the bathrooms and showers, which are well-maintained.
- On-site Restaurant / Snack Bar: A convenient on-site restaurant or snack bar provides easy access to meals and treats.
- Retail and Gift Shop: A well-stocked retail and gift shop is available for camping essentials, souvenirs, and activities like gem mining bags.
- Laundry Room: Modern laundry facilities are provided, a valuable amenity for longer stays.
- Wi-Fi Access: The campground offers property-wide Wi-Fi, allowing guests to stay connected, though performance can vary in mountainous terrain.
- Propane Sales: Propane is available for purchase on-site, a practical service for RVers.
- Pet Walk / Dog Park: A designated pet walk area and a general pet-friendly policy (dogs must be on a leash no longer than 6 feet) make it welcoming for furry companions.
- Sanitary Dump Station: A convenient dump station is available for RVs.
- Campground Store: For quick necessities, firewood, and recreational items.
Features / Highlights:
- Family-Friendly Recreation: The campground is packed with activities designed for all ages, including two playgrounds for children, a large jump pad for bouncing fun, and a gem mining activity for aspiring prospectors.
- Stunning Mountain Views: Located in a valley surrounded by the San Juan Mountains, the campground offers breathtaking panoramic views from almost every site.
- Proximity to Ouray and Ridgway: Enjoy easy access to the charming towns of Ouray (known for its hot springs, Box Canyon Falls, and "Switzerland of America" nickname) and Ridgway (offering state park activities and a vibrant arts scene).
- Access to Outdoor Activities: The KOA serves as an ideal base for exploring the region's extensive outdoor recreation opportunities, including hiking, mountain biking, cycling trails, whitewater rafting, zip-lining, and especially off-roading.
- KOA Jeep Rentals: For those looking to explore the challenging and scenic high mountain passes, the campground offers convenient Jeep rentals on-site.
- Themed Events: Throughout the season, the campground hosts various themed events, fostering a fun and communal atmosphere for guests.
- Quiet and Well-Maintained Grounds: Despite the activity, the campground is noted for being well-maintained and generally quiet, offering a peaceful retreat.
- Hot Tub: Some KOA Holiday locations, including Ouray, may offer a hot tub for guest relaxation (confirm directly with the campground).
- Close to Major Attractions: Easy access to iconic Colorado sites such as the Ouray Hot Springs Pool, Box Canyon Falls Park, the Million Dollar Highway, Ridgway State Park, and even the West Gold Hill Dinosaur Tracks.
